Lake Effect Photographic Adventures Presents: Join us for a day of photography at one of Northern Illinois' finest wildflower sites. We'll start our day at 8 am at Messenger Woods Forest Preserve. Large-flowered Trilliums (White Trillium), Blue Eyed Marys, and Virginia Bluebells are the star flower attractions here, but there are also many other species of wildflowers as well as the Spring Creek shoreline to photograph. After the event, many participants will head out for a late lunch. Will and Hank will demonstrate using a histogram to make great exposures for those who do not yet use this very powerful tool. Hank will demonstrate some close up techniques for flowers and Will will demonstrate techniques for making spring flower landscapes. Both instructors will assist you with composition and help you make memorable wildflower images. |
